Ticket: QUEUE-412. While migrating from our homegrown Tanglewheel job queue to Ferrowline, we discovered the service account credentials for the Mossgate scheduler expired last Friday, so replay jobs are silently failing. Until the automated rotation lands, maintainers should update the Ferrowline worker config by hand after each rotation. The replacement credential for the Mossgate scheduler, valid for ninety days, is provided below.

API key for yahig-tadup: kto7_ubizbYm

Welcome to Fernway Analytics! Our canteen on the ground floor of Holloway Court is shared with our neighbours at Tindale Robotics, so expect unfamiliar faces at lunch — that's normal. Tindale staff use the east entrance; Fernway staff should always enter through the west doors by the atrium. Keep your lanyard visible at all times while in the shared seating area. To unlock the west canteen doors, enter the code below.

door code, yagap-bahof: bdg-O-05

Handover: EchoDock audio-guide app. Taking over from me mid-refactor of the playback service. Exhibit-sync logic moved to the new scheduler; old polling code still in tree but dead — delete in next pass. Known issue: offline bundle downloads stall on flaky connections, fix is half-done on my branch. Tests green except the flaky geofence suite, skip it for now. Review focus: the scheduler diff, nothing else changed materially. Runtime settings the staging build expects are as follows.

config for yajof-yaduf:
[novok]
port = 9300
region = outer-2
host = novok.sivreltech.example
team = rusath
timeout_ms = 250
retries = 1